Transaction 2e1583724e1f106ede4441806a24cd2c7c8e4f37e780a16ef66830eb25d22f38
2 Input
2 Outputs
- 2e1583724e1f106ede4441806a24cd2c7c8e4f37e780a16ef66830eb25d22f38:0
- 2e1583724e1f106ede4441806a24cd2c7c8e4f37e780a16ef66830eb25d22f38:1
value 20000000
address 3ASBHq3wcRngun4SzuuLzCMWrVSopAoKyj
value 22733551
address 32jPMzNzHKE2f6u6V1Ch9qxXXf456D83F5